Could it be that they were spawned there while it was dark? In Bedrock Edition, mobs get saved to their location when their chunks are unloaded. So when you return to the area in the daytime, it may just be loading back the old mobs.

I've built silentwisperer's raid farm design and it tries to limit the available spawn blocks to a water platform at the top. But as shown in his video and happening to me in my realm, sometimes they spawn INSIDE solid walls and suffocate to death. One time a pillager spawned halfway out from the edge of the wall but was not pushed out, nor did it suffocate and I had to kill it manually.
Can confirm. Before 1.21, I was able to launch from Y = 62 to 102 with Riptide III. Now in 1.21.50 I am only launched from Y = 62 to 93 with Riptide III. I had a sky base that was accessible by a Riptide III trident under the previous condition, and now I cannot access it without workarounds (such as reducing the distance between my water launching pad and the entry path, which ruins the aesthetic of the build I intended).
